Fascism, historically, has been associated with a genuine concern for the 
poor inside of the fascist nation-state. This has been one of the reasons 
for its success in finding converts. This concern is lacking in 
neoconservatism, which it otherwise resembles. So while there is formal 
similarity that is instructive, it is probably an insult to fascism to 
associate it with neoconservatism.
